Nelson Mandela Bay Shines at the 2025 Savanna Newcomer Showcase!

The laughter was loud, the energy electric, and the stakes high at the 2025 Savanna Newcomer Showcase, held on Sunday, January 26, in Sandton. This sold-out event, hosted by award-winning comedian Tumi Morake, saw 20 of South Africa’s freshest comedic talents battle it out with their best five-minute sets, all vying for a nomination in the prestigious Savanna Newcomer Award category at the upcoming Savanna Comics’ Choice Comedy Awards on April 12.

Nelson Mandela Bay in the Spotlight

This year, Nelson Mandela Bay proudly had three representatives on stage:

  • Chantal Harris – (@chantal_harris_comedy)
  • Dombolo – (@domboloralo)
  • Zaheer Gaida

These local stars brought their unique comedic perspectives to the national stage, showcasing the humor, charm, and grit that make Nelson Mandela Bay a hub of talent.
